Hey Gang
Talk about right down to the wire
With only 20 min left in my season after callin for hour or so I got ready to pack it in as the season was winding down
Behind me I heard a branch snap so I just sat there waiting to see a old coon or something pop out and low and behold out stepped a Tom
He didnt look like he was doing anything other than going out for a stroll
I thought is this real and slowly brought up my gun
He kept walking and he was about 20 or so yards away and I took the shot
He just floped over kind of weird and hardly even twitched
I just sat there for a moment and thought that is the strangest thing I ever have saw turkey hunting
Well I will take it he was my second bird of the year and the season is now done
I dont know what to say about this season but it was a adventure for sure
First bird was a walk up on 10 min into the season and now this
The rest of the season was a huge leason and I learned tons
Well tonights bird was smaller than my first

21.3125 + 8.75 + 7.5 + 20 = 57.5625

Pics to follow not sure what this does to our score but anything helps I guess
Thanks for the season all, it was a hoot!
